"Let's go, Queen."
Before leaving, Sukuna deliberately stretched out a hand toward Rika. Since she was a "spirit" attached to Yuta, then naturally she should belong to him now as well.
"You... give Yuta back!"
Rika refused. Her soul rejected the "Yuta" before her, yet at the same time it told her that her Yuta was still there and had not disappeared. But she could not bring herself to attack that face, so all she could do was shout angrily.
"That's right. We won't let you leave."
Todo stood beside Yuji. Both of them had already decided to stop Sukuna no matter what.
(Kashimo was still frozen in ice shouting nonstop and still being ignored by everyone.)
"And me too!"
A voice came from the sky.
It was Megumi with wings spread across his back. After receiving the heavily injured Inumaki and Panda outside the barrier, he chose to join the battlefield as well.
Having been guided by his uncle regarding both his body and cursed technique, Megumi's mastery over the Ten Shadows Technique had improved dramatically.
He no longer needed to summon Nue itself to fly. Just like his uncle, he could now partially manifest and attach wings directly onto his back through technique extension.
And just like now, after entering the barrier he immediately flew into the sky searching for the center of the cursed energy clash. What he did not expect was to arrive in the middle of a situation this disastrous.
Even without seeing everything firsthand, Megumi could easily guess what happened. Yuji had probably been too naive again and got tricked by Sukuna. And Yuta ended up suffering the consequences.
"Fushiguro!"
The arrival of another ally lifted Yuji's spirits again.
"We'll talk later after we get out of here."
"With this treasure, I summon—"
Ignoring Yuji's attempt at greeting him, Megumi had already begun forming hand signs midair.
"One after another..."
Megumi's arrival had been entirely within Sukuna's expectations.
In his current incomplete state, unable to fully use either his own power or Yuta's, Sukuna knew he could not quickly deal with the troublesome monster from the Ten Shadows Technique. And after the battle in Shibuya, there was a high chance that creature had already completely adapted to his slashes just like before.
Most troublesome of all, if Megumi was here, then that annoying man could appear at any moment too.
Sukuna raised his fingers. He intended to shoot Megumi down before Mahoraga could fully manifest.
Clap!
But just as the slash fired, a sharp clap suddenly echoed.
The person in the air switched places with Todo.
"—Eight-Handled Sword Divergent Sila Divine General Mahoraga."
The chant and hand signs were already complete. From the shadows behind Megumi, that familiar terrifying figure stepped out once more. Even the ground beneath it cracked apart from the pressure of its appearance.
Clap!
Another clap rang out, and Todo and Mahoraga switched positions.
The several slashes Sukuna released all landed directly on Mahoraga's body, yet not a single wound appeared.
It had completely adapted to slashing attacks.
"So this is your trump card? It's even scarier than I imagined~"
Todo raised one hand above his eyes to block the sunlight while staring upward in amazement.
He already knew the Ten Shadows Technique contained an absurdly powerful shikigami, but this was his first time seeing it personally. Reputation truly could not compare to reality.
"Enough talking. Heal first."
The wings behind Megumi disappeared. Then he summoned Round Deer, the shikigami capable of using Reverse Cursed Technique, to heal Todo and Yuji's injuries.
Mahoraga alone was enough to hold Sukuna back.
"Tch..."
Meanwhile, Uraume, Sukuna's number one admirer and loyal follower for over a thousand years, could not understand the audacity of these people at all.
Watching Mahoraga descend from the sky toward them, she immediately raised both hands. An overwhelming amount of cursed energy burst from her sleeves.
"Ice Formation Technique: Frost Calm!"
A gigantic glacier erupted upward from the earth and instantly froze the completely defenseless Mahoraga inside.
"Sukuna-sama, forgive my disrespect, but I want to kill them all."
Uraume simply could not tolerate these people still acting so boldly before Sukuna.
"There's no need to waste time. It'll become troublesome if that shameless thing arrives."
Sukuna rejected her proposal immediately.
Uraume had not participated in the Shibuya Incident, so she did not understand Mahoraga's true terror and believed her technique had already defeated it.
But if one looked closely, cracks had already begun slowly spreading from the center of the glacier imprisoning Mahoraga. And the wheel above its head had begun turning slowly.
Just like Sukuna's slashes, Uraume's ice technique was fundamentally a relatively simple cursed technique. It only became terrifying because of the overwhelming strength of its user. As such, Mahoraga would not need long to adapt.
Every second trapped inside the ice allowed it to continuously adapt to Uraume's technique. It probably would not even take a full minute before it shattered free completely.
If this were Sukuna at full power, defeating these three brats within a minute would be effortless.
But unfortunately, that was impossible now.
And Rika still had not obeyed his commands. Even if she did, she would still be useless against Mahoraga.
Despite being called the Queen of Curses, at her core she was still only a vengeful cursed spirit created from Yuta's obsessive love and the accumulation of countless curses. And the Sword of Extermination wielded by Mahoraga happened to be the natural enemy of all cursed spirits.
No matter how many curses existed, a few strikes from that blade would erase them completely.
The current situation was extremely unfavorable for Sukuna's side. And the best option right now was to leave before Mukuro and Satoru arrived.
"As you command, Sukuna-sama."
Uraume abandoned the idea of fighting. Displeased as she felt, Sukuna's orders always came first. That conviction had never changed over the last thousand years.
So the two turned around and prepared to leave.
But at that exact moment, the situation Sukuna least wanted to see finally happened.
"Uncle Mukuro!"
After glancing once toward his still-healing companions, Megumi realized there was no way to stop Sukuna from leaving without Mahoraga, so he could only shout.
The next instant, his head lowered.
A gentle breeze suddenly blew past, causing the hair over his forehead to sway softly as the aura around him began changing.
Nothing about his appearance changed outwardly. Yet even from over ten meters away, Sukuna and Uraume could smell a heavy scent of blood.
It was like someone had just walked through a river made entirely of blood. The thick metallic smell filled the air.
Then, when Megumi slowly raised his head again, that once youthful face now carried absolute dominance.
A crimson number "6" appeared within his right eye.
The strongest of the modern era, Six Paths Mukuro had arrived.
